技术文摘
ASP 连接 SQL 数据库的方法
2025-01-15 03:15:14 小编
ASP 连接 SQL 数据库的方法
在动态网站开发中,ASP(Active Server Pages)与 SQL 数据库的连接至关重要,它能实现数据的存储、读取与管理,为网站提供强大的功能支持。下面就为大家详细介绍几种常见的 ASP 连接 SQL 数据库的方法。
首先是使用 ODBC 数据源连接。这种方式较为传统且通用。第一步要在服务器的控制面板中创建 ODBC 数据源。打开“管理工具”,进入“数据源(ODBC)”,在“系统 DSN”选项卡下点击“添加”,选择 SQL Server 驱动程序,按照向导提示完成设置,包括填写数据源名称、服务器地址、登录信息等。在 ASP 代码中,通过以下语句进行连接:
<%
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"DSN=数据源名称;UID=用户名;PWD=密码"
%>
其次是使用 OLE DB 连接,这是一种更高效的连接方式。在 ASP 代码里,使用如下代码实现连接:
<%
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"Provider=SQLOLEDB;Data Source=服务器名;Initial Catalog=数据库名;User ID=用户名;Password=密码"
%>
这里的“Provider”指定了 OLE DB 提供程序,“Data Source”为服务器地址,“Initial Catalog”是要连接的数据库名称。
还有一种通过 SQL Native Client 连接的方法。这需要安装 SQL Native Client 组件。连接代码如下:
<%
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"Provider=SQLNCLI11;Server=服务器名;Database=数据库名;Uid=用户名;Pwd=密码"
%>
在实际应用中,不同的连接方法各有优缺点。ODBC 数据源连接兼容性强,但性能相对较弱;OLE DB 连接效率高,应用广泛;SQL Native Client 连接则针对 SQL Server 进行了优化。开发人员需要根据具体项目需求、服务器环境等因素综合选择合适的连接方式。掌握这些 ASP 连接 SQL 数据库的方法,能为动态网站开发打下坚实基础,有效提升开发效率与质量。
- 全球分布式算力共享先驱探寻外星人 21 年竟无果?
- 微软中国 CTO 韦青:低代码与无代码时代来临
- Netflix 的六边形架构应用实践
- AR 行业风雨飘零 苹果能否撑起半边天
- 微服务设计选型的超全参考
- 200 行 JS 代码助力实现代码编译器
- 2020 年跨平台开发框架现状剖析
- 四个优秀实践助力写出高质量 JavaScript 模块
- 前端大文件快速上传的开发实现
- 在 GitHub 上借助 Python 运行博客
- 6 个前端开发必备工具,缺一不可!
- Jmeter 各类线程组深度解析
- 新一轮前端面试到来,你踩雷了吗?
- Servelt3 异步请求:多数程序员未知的简单秘诀
- 阿里集团内 Flutter 体系化建设的路径